Fix Central

What is it?

  • One-stop shopping to find and download fixes and fix packs for your system's software
  • Find the fixes or fix packs you are looking for by searching by product, release, OS, fix ID, and/or APAR number, or by a full text search of the associated fix descriptions
  • Helps you identify any prerequisite or co-requisite fixes associated with the fixes you want to download

Who is it for?

All IBM customers, but note that some downloads require the Web ID to be entitled in order to successfully download fixes through Fix Central. This is the same ID you use to open up PMRs electronically.

Service Request (ESR/SR - to electronically open a PMR)

What is it?

  • An electronic problem submission tool that allows you to submit and manage PMRs (Problem Management Records) electronically 24 hours a day
  • Allows you to describe the software problem you are having and your environment in your own words (eliminates having to call the call center)
  • IBM representatives review your electronic PMR and work with you to resolve it the same as voice PMRs
  • You receive the same precedence as a PMR called in over the phone (both types are treated first-come-first-serve in the queue)
  • Lets you monitor and update all of your open PMRs and view closed PMRs without having to call Support to get the update

Who is it for?

IBM Software customers with an active Support contract

Assist On-site

What is it?

  • A live remote-assistance tool used to help resolve complex issues
  • Allows IBM support team members to securely view and share control of your desktop
  • Speeds up problem determination, collection of data, and ultimately, your problem solution
  • You use Assist On-site after opening a problem via the normal methods and the support engineer decides whether this tool is the right approach for your particular problem
  • Once you connect to the service, you are prompted to download a small, self-installing plug-in
  • At any time during a support session, you can take control of your computer just by moving your mouse; you are in charge at all times

Who is it for?

IBM Software customers with an active Support contract

Lotus Domino Configuration Tuner

What is it?

  • A FREE tool that runs on one or more active Lotus Domino servers (designed to work best with Domino V7.0 and above)
  • Checks Domino server settings against a list of best practice rules to identify configuration problems
  • Generates reports that explain possible configuration issues with positive suggestions for action and references to supporting information
  • Allows for periodic health checks of your Domino infrastructure
  • Regularly updated with new rules as Domino evolves and new best practices are identified

Who is it for?

IBM Lotus Domino server administrators
